Chef critique
Malaysian Coconut Chicken & Eggplant Curry
A flavorful and appealing weeknight curry with well-structured parallel cooking steps and clear, complete instructions. However, the recipe must be revised because the meat and vegetables are substantially underseasoned during the active cooking stages, and the amount of oil provided for sautéing the eggplant is impractically low.
Score: 7/10
Suggested fixes
- Increase the kosher salt on the chicken to 3/4 teaspoon and on the vegetables to at least 1/2 teaspoon during the initial sautéing steps.
- To prevent the dish from becoming overly salty once the meat and vegetables are properly seasoned, reduce the fish sauce to 1 to 2 teaspoons, or instruct the user to add it to taste at the end.
- Increase the neutral cooking oil in Step 4 to at least 1 to 2 tablespoons, or instruct the cook to add a splash of water and cover the pan briefly to help the eggplant steam-soften.
- Update the total kosher salt and cooking oil quantities in the ingredient list to reflect these changes.
Issues
- high / flavor: The chicken and vegetables are severely underseasoned during initial cooking. Based on a 1.25% salt by weight starting point, 12 oz (340g) of chicken requires about 4.25g of salt (approx. 3/4 to 1 tsp kosher salt), but receives only 1/4 tsp. Similarly, 16 oz (450g) of eggplant and onion require about 4.5g of salt (1% salinity), but receive only 1/4 tsp. Fish sauce added later does not correct unseasoned meat.
- medium / cookability: Step 4 calls for cooking 12 oz of cubed eggplant and half an onion in just 1 teaspoon of oil. Eggplant is highly porous and will absorb this tiny amount of oil instantly, which will likely cause sticking or burning before the eggplant softens.
